Abstract

The purpose of this research is to develop professional competency model in the field of goldsmith and jewelry education and food industry and service education. The model was developed with the learning process of the national education act 1999 and the higher education commission 15 year plan in lifting up higher education quality standard, producing higher workforce, emphasizing on international competition, building network among institutions and certifying qualification in vocational area with border
countries. The competency ideas offered to the research are from Mc. CLElland theory and UNESCO in career and vocational qualification competency.

For research design, populations are of the five goldsmith and jewelry institutions and five food and service industry institutions in the interview with the experts, the specialists, the employers and the institution administrators. Only the open-ended questionnaire technique was used for the instructors. After the interviews, data was analyzed by the content
analysis, mean, S.D. and F-Test.

Summary of research is that competency of the graduates should come from industry standard. The experience study from the industry has made specialized skill for the student. Institution and industry should corporate each other with qualification in curriculum planning and assessment.

  • Industry should be part of field experience and institutional curriculum by being committee to define the skill standard, and for providing the standard set-up for solidification of the improved system of national qualification and quality assurance process as the stakeholders’ responsiveness. The collected data shows the key competency, were the experience in working, the insight attitude, trait, and knowledge. The highly skill in verbal representing English communication is very important as well as computer skill.
